Output 32bd8b53e2a78f24f2c307d03a15a3018f7bb85047c60cfee961979d730c21f7:0

value
31515851
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5884486c262f837671f7dacb0d366d5a4bfd91fa OP_EQUALVERIFY OP_CHECKSIG
address
1952w4NWGpALtzfbrWtazyVZK3zeACUu4k
transaction
32bd8b53e2a78f24f2c307d03a15a3018f7bb85047c60cfee961979d730c21f7
spent
true